A lichen is a symbiotic association of a fungus and a photosynthesizing partner, such as a green algae or cyanobacterium. The symbiosis is usually obligate for the fungus. The goal of this study was to generate genome information for phylogenetic analysis from the cultured mycobionts (lichenizing fungi) and lichen thalli spanning the diversity of lichenized groups in the classes Lecanoromycetes, Eurotiomycetes, Dothidiomycetes, Arthoniomycetes and Lichinomycetes. Leptogium austroamericanum is a lichen composed of the lichenizing fungus Leptogium austroamericanum (for which the association is named) and its cyanobacterial photobiont. The metagenome data here include sequences from the lichenizing fungus Leptogium austroamericanum (class Lecanoromycetes, subclass Lecanoromycetidae), the cyanobacterial photobiont, and possibly endolichenic fungi or prokaryotes.
